General Allen Hunt Rider: Return of Commander of Army of Occupation May Mean Amateur Racing Revival., Daily Racing Form, 1923-01-15

GENERAL ALLEN HUNT RIDER Return of Commander of Army of Occupation May Mean Amateur Racing Revival Major General Henry T Allen command ¬ ing the American army of occupation in Germany will be back in this country within thirty days and his return means that ama ¬ I teur racing and the hunt meetings will have its sturdiest champpion on hand General Allen has ever been active in these meetings and an accomplished rider himself has taken part in many of the races He is a member of the Piping Rock Racing Association and his return might mean the awakening of an interest that would result in a race meeting over that delightfully picturesque course during the year yearDuring During his stay in Coblenz General Allen always kept in touch with the amateur and hunt racing in this country and he had programs mailed him of each meeting While there he also conducted successful race meet Ings and at one of them another American K Rockwell officiated as starter
